Weekend Utility: Towing, Cargo, Outdoor Gear, and Local Projects
When the weekend arrives, the comparison between Ford and Toyota becomes more capability-focused. Toyota offers respected trucks and SUVs, including Tacoma, Tundra, 4Runner, Sequoia, and Land Cruiser. Those vehicles have strong reputations among outdoor-minded shoppers, and Toyota is a sensible choice for drivers who want rugged styling and proven engineering.
Ford, however, has built much of its brand identity around getting work done and making recreation easier. The Ford truck lineup is especially deep, starting with the compact Maverick, moving to the midsize Ranger, and continuing through the F-150® and Super Duty® family. That gives shoppers more room to right-size capability. Not every driver needs a heavy-duty truck, but some drivers absolutely do. Ford makes it easier to choose between efficient urban utility, midsize adventure, full-size towing, or serious commercial-grade hauling.
Features such as available Pro Trailer Backup Assist™, available onboard scales on select trucks, integrated trailer technology, and available Pro Power Onboard™ help Ford stand apart for owners who tow, camp, work from a jobsite, or power tools away from home. Around Royal Palm Beach and nearby communities like Wellington and Loxahatchee, that can matter for equestrian activities, landscape projects, small business needs, and weekend towing. Toyota trucks are capable, but Ford offers a broader toolbox for drivers who want technology built around trailering and jobsite productivity.

Family SUV Choices: Ford Flexibility vs Toyota Familiarity
Ford and Toyota both offer strong SUV lineups. Toyota vehicles such as RAV4, Highlander, Grand Highlander, 4Runner, and Sequoia cover a wide range of family needs. Toyota is especially appealing for drivers who want a familiar SUV experience with efficient hybrid availability across several models.
Ford offers a different kind of strength: variety across personality and purpose. Ford Escape is a practical compact SUV for commuters and small families. Ford Bronco Sport® adds adventure-ready styling in a manageable footprint. Ford Explorer brings three-row versatility with confident road manners. Ford Expedition is built for families who need generous space, strong towing ability, and full-size comfort. Ford Bronco® appeals to drivers who want open-air capability and off-road character that feels distinct from a traditional crossover.
For Palm Beach County families, the Ford SUV lineup can feel more tailored. Some shoppers want easy parking at shopping centers near State Road 7. Others want extra room for sports gear, luggage, and relatives visiting from out of town. Some want a vehicle that feels refined on the highway but still capable for a dirt road or boat ramp. Toyota covers many family basics well, but Ford often gives shoppers more personality and capability within the SUV category.
